Skip to main content
3 bedroom detached house for sale xylofagou larnaca 1717493 image 4568671
3 bedroom detached house for sale xylofagou larnaca 1717493 image 4568670
3 bedroom detached house for sale xylofagou larnaca 1717493 image 4568669
3 bedroom detached house for sale xylofagou larnaca 1717493 image 4568668
3 bedroom detached house for sale xylofagou larnaca 1717493 image 4568667
3 bedroom detached house for sale xylofagou larnaca 1717493 image 4568666
3 bedroom detached house for sale xylofagou larnaca 1717493 image 4568665
3 bedroom detached house for sale xylofagou larnaca 1717493 image 4568664
3 bedroom detached house for sale xylofagou larnaca 1717493 image 4568663
3 bedroom detached house for sale xylofagou larnaca 1717493 image 4568662
3 bedroom detached house for sale xylofagou larnaca 1717493 image 4568661
3 bedroom detached house for sale xylofagou larnaca 1717493 image 4568660
3 bedroom detached house for sale xylofagou larnaca 1717493 image 4568659
3 bedroom detached house for sale xylofagou larnaca 1717493 image 4568658
3 bedroom detached house for sale xylofagou larnaca 1717493 image 4568657